London: Robert G Sawers, 1974. xii, 292pp, index, 216 bw ill. Maroon textured silk boards with page marker ribbon, in jacket. Light edge wear to jacket, minor abrasion to front free endpaper from removal of prev owner label, light toning/foxing to page edges, small taped tear to bottom rear of jacket with associated scuff to rear board. 216 outstanding tsuba are illustrated and described in full. 21 major schools of tsuba production are explained from the standpoints of spiritual and military background. An imprtant reference in the field.. Enlarged Edition. Hard Cover. Very Good/Very Good. Illus. by Shihachi Fujimoto. Small 4to.
